Discourse analysis reveals five health discourses in Norwegian education policy, suggesting implications for health promotion.

Key Points

  • This study aims to explore health and well-being discourses in Norwegian education policy documents.
  • Adopts discourse analysis focusing on Bacchi's WPR approach
  • Examines three policy documents, including the Norwegian core curriculum and two White Papers
  • Identifies underlying assumptions related to health representations in the documents
  • Identified five distinct health discourses, primarily linking health issues to academic achievement
  • Limited emphasis on the impact of pedagogical practices on students' health and well-being
  • Highlighted the narrow focus on pupil agency within the health promotion context
